  • The Rules of Civility and Decent Behaviour in Company and Conversation

    03/05/2006 7:57:56 AM PST · by cougar_mccxxi · 19 replies · 539+ views
    National Center ^ | Unknown | George Washington
    1 Every action done in company ought to be with some sign of respect to those that are present. 2 When in company, put not your hands to any part of the body not usually discovered. 3 Show nothing to your friend that may affright him. 4 In the presence of others, sing not to yourself with a humming voice, or drum with your fingers or feet. 5 If you cough, sneeze, sigh, or yawn, do it not loud but privately, and speak not in your yawning, but put your handkerchief or hand before your face and turn aside. 6...

  • FL Judge reporting illegals! "Judge accused of abusing power by reporting immigrant children"

    02/07/2004 5:58:18 PM PST · by getmeouttaPalmBeachCounty_FL · 29 replies · 428+ views
    The Miami Herald Online ^ | Posted on Mon, Jan. 19, 2004 | AP
    WEST PALM BEACH - (AP) -- A judge is being criticized for openly questioning and often reporting the immigration status of abused, abandoned and neglected children in his courtroom. Some lawyers call Roger B. Colton's actions disturbing, saying he abuses his power by revealing to law enforcement details disclosed before him. Colton says he is just doing his duty. ''They're violating the law, and I'm a judge,'' said Colton, whose background included nine years as a special agent with the FBI. ``Don't I have some type of obligation to the system to report it . . . when it's smack-dab...
